Once you’ve decided that you want to change then it’s time to create a plan and ACT.

You got to start small and build up from there. It’s how you’ll stay consistent and not burn yourself out. 

So, focus on just hitting the gym 3X a week consistently. You’ll be insanely sore in the beginning, and probably spend more time than you should and that’s OKAY.

Be patient with yourself. Remember it’s a marathon not a sprint.

I’d recommend you follow a push, pull and leg day split. You need to hit those compound exercises and gradually increase the weight as you get stronger.

Second, you need to eat at least 1 gram of protein per pound of body weight. So, if I weigh 160 pounds then I need to eat at least 160 grams of protein (this should be straightforward). 

Third, buy some protein powder and some creatine. Take the creatine religiously (5MG) every single day and take your protein powder when you haven’t eaten enough protein on any specific day. 

Fourth, is to optimise your sleep. You build muscle when you sleep and so aim for quality. Get your 7 – 9 hours daily and remove alcohol from your diet. Alcohol will destroy your gains, testosterone and sleep.
